Price Sheet - Download By Billing Account
등록 ID에 따라 제공된 청구 기간의 가격표를 비동기적으로 생성합니다. 기업계약 고객을 위한 것입니다.
버전 2024-08-01 마이그레이션
새 URI와 함께 2024-08-01 API 버전을 사용할 수 있습니다.
'/providers/Microsoft.Billing/billingAccounts/{billingAccountId}/billingPeriods/{billingPeriodName}/providers/Microsoft.CostManagement/pricesheets/default/download'
아래에 자세히 설명된 새 스키마를 사용하여 가격표의 새 버전은 추가 정보를 제공하고 현재 청구 기간의 RI(Azure Reserved Instances)에 대한 가격을 포함합니다. 이전 RI(Azure Reserved Instance) 가격 책정에 대한 지속적인 레코드를 유지 관리하는 경우 새 청구 기간을 입력할 때 Azure 가격표를 다운로드하는 것이 좋습니다.
EA Azure 가격표는 지난 13개월 동안 청구 기간에 사용할 수 있습니다. 13개월 이전의 청구 기간에 대한 가격표를 요청하려면 고객 지원에 문의하세요.
Azure 가격표 다운로드 환경은 단일 .csv 파일에서 각각 최대 크기가 75MB인 여러 .csv 파일이 포함된 zip 파일로 업데이트되었습니다. 2023-11-01 버전은 http POST 메서드를 사용하도록 업그레이드되었습니다. 자세한 내용은 아래에서 확인할 수 있습니다.
모든 버전의 Microsoft.Consumption Azure 가격표 - 청구 계정으로 다운로드(2022-06-01 포함, 2021-10-01, 2020-01-01-preview, 2019-10-01, 2019-05-01)는 2026년 6월 1일에 사용 중지될 예정이며 이 날짜 이후에는 더 이상 지원되지 않습니다.
POST https://management.azure.com/providers/Microsoft.Billing/billingAccounts/{billingAccountId}/billingPeriods/{billingPeriodName}/providers/Microsoft.CostManagement/pricesheets/default/download?api-version=2024-08-01
URI 매개 변수
Name | In(다음 안에) | 필수 | 형식 | Description |
---|---|---|---|---|
billing
|
path | True |
string |
BillingAccount ID |
billing
|
path | True |
string |
청구 기간 이름입니다. regex 패턴: |
api-version
|
query | True |
string |
이 작업에 사용할 API 버전입니다. |
응답
Name | 형식 | Description |
---|---|---|
200 OK |
그래. 요청이 성공했습니다. |
|
202 Accepted |
허용. 헤더
|
|
Other Status Codes |
작업이 실패한 이유를 설명하는 오류 응답입니다. |
보안
azure_auth
Azure Active Directory OAuth2 Flow.
형식:
oauth2
Flow:
implicit
권한 부여 URL:
https://login.microsoftonline.com/common/oauth2/authorize
범위
Name | Description |
---|---|
user_impersonation | 사용자 계정 가장 |
예제
EAPriceSheetForBillingPeriod
샘플 요청
POST https://management.azure.com/providers/Microsoft.Billing/billingAccounts/0000000/billingPeriods/202311/providers/Microsoft.CostManagement/pricesheets/default/download?api-version=2024-08-01
샘플 응답
Location: https://management.azure.com/providers/Microsoft.Billing/billingAccounts/0000000/providers/Microsoft.CostManagement/operationResults/00000000-0000-0000-0000-000000000000?api-version=2023-09-01
Retry-After: 60
{
"status": "Completed",
"properties": {
"downloadUrl": "https://myaccount.blob.core.windows.net/?restype=service&comp=properties&sv=2015-04-05&ss=bf&srt=s&st=2015-04-29T22%3A18%3A26Z&se=2015-04-30T02%3A23%3A26Z&sr=b&sp=rw&spr=https&sig=G%2TEST%4B",
"validTill": "2023-09-30T17:32:28Z"
}
}
정의
Name | Description |
---|---|
EAPrice |
EA 가격표의 속성입니다. 버전 2024-08-01에서 지원되는 속성은 다음과 같습니다. |
Error |
오류의 세부 정보입니다. |
Error |
오류 응답은 서비스에서 들어오는 요청을 처리할 수 없음을 나타냅니다. 그 이유는 오류 메시지에 제공됩니다. 일부 오류 응답:
|
Operation |
장기 실행 작업의 상태입니다. |
Operation |
장기 실행 작업의 상태입니다. |
EAPriceSheetProperties
EA 가격표의 속성입니다. 버전 2024-08-01에서 지원되는 속성은 다음과 같습니다.
Name | 형식 | Description |
---|---|---|
basePrice |
string |
고객이 로그인한 시점의 단가 또는 서비스 미터 GA 시작 시의 단가(로그온 후인 경우)입니다. 기업계약 사용자에게 적용됩니다. |
currencyCode |
string |
기업계약이 체결된 통화 |
effectiveEndDate |
string |
가격표 청구 기간의 유효 종료 날짜 |
effectiveStartDate |
string |
가격표 청구 기간의 유효 시작 날짜 |
enrollmentNumber |
string |
EA 청구 계정에 대한 고유 식별자입니다. |
includedQuantity |
string |
EA 고객이 증분 요금 없이 사용할 수 있는 특정 서비스의 수량입니다. |
marketPrice |
string |
지정된 제품 또는 서비스의 현재 정가입니다. 이 가격은 어떠한 협상도 하지 않으며 Microsoft 계약 유형을 기반으로 합니다. PriceType 소비의 경우 시장 가격은 종량제 가격으로 반영됩니다. PriceType 저축 플랜의 경우 시장 가격은 해당 약정 기간에 대한 종량제 가격 위에 저축 플랜 혜택을 반영합니다. PriceType ReservedInstance의 경우 시장 가격은 1년 또는 3년 약정의 총 가격을 반영합니다. 참고: 협상이 없는 EA 고객의 경우 시장 가격이 단가와 다른 소수 자릿수로 반올림된 것처럼 보일 수 있습니다. |
meterCategory |
string |
측정기의 분류 범주 이름입니다. 예를 들어 클라우드 서비스, 네트워킹 등이 있습니다. |
meterId |
string |
미터의 고유 식별자 |
meterName |
string |
미터의 이름입니다. 미터는 Azure 서비스의 배포 가능한 리소스를 나타냅니다. |
meterRegion |
string |
서비스의 미터를 사용할 수 있는 Azure 지역의 이름입니다. |
meterSubCategory |
string |
미터 하위 분류 범주의 이름입니다. |
meterType |
string |
미터 형식의 이름 |
offerId |
string |
이 미터와 연결된 Azure 제품을 결정합니다. [Azure 제품에 대해 자세히 알아보기] (https://azure.microsoft.com/en-us/support/legal/offer-details/) |
partNumber |
string |
미터와 연결된 부품 번호 |
priceType |
string |
제품의 가격 유형입니다. 예를 들어 priceType을 소비로 사용하는 종량제 요금이 있는 Azure 리소스입니다. 다른 가격 유형에는 ReservedInstance 및 저축 계획이 포함됩니다. |
product |
string |
요금이 발생하는 제품의 이름입니다. |
productId |
string |
측정기가 사용되는 제품의 고유 식별자입니다. |
serviceFamily |
number |
Azure 서비스의 유형입니다. 예를 들어 컴퓨팅, 분석 및 보안입니다. |
skuId |
string |
SKU의 고유 식별자 |
term |
string |
Azure 저축 계획 또는 예약 기간의 기간 - 1년 또는 3년(P1Y 또는 P3Y) |
unitOfMeasure |
string |
서비스에 대한 사용량을 측정하는 방법입니다. 참고: "Unit" 필드가 버전 2023-11-01에서 "UnitofMeasure"의 중복으로 제거되었습니다. "UnitOfMeasure" 필드를 사용하세요. |
unitPrice |
string |
지정된 제품 또는 서비스에 대한 청구 시점의 단가로, 시장 가격을 기준으로 협상된 할인을 포함합니다. PriceType ReservedInstance의 경우 단가는 할인을 포함한 1년 또는 3년 약정의 총 비용을 반영합니다. 참고: 단가는 서비스에 계층 간에 차등 가격이 있는 경우 사용량 세부 정보 다운로드의 유효 가격과 동일하지 않습니다. 서비스에 다중 계층 가격이 있는 경우 유효 가격은 계층 전체에서 혼합된 요금이며 계층별 단가를 표시하지 않습니다. 혼합 가격 또는 유효 가격은 여러 계층에 걸쳐 있는 소비된 수량의 순 가격입니다(각 계층에 특정 단가가 있음). |
ErrorDetails
오류의 세부 정보입니다.
Name | 형식 | Description |
---|---|---|
code |
string |
오류 코드입니다. |
message |
string |
작업이 실패한 이유를 나타내는 오류 메시지입니다. |
ErrorResponse
오류 응답은 서비스에서 들어오는 요청을 처리할 수 없음을 나타냅니다. 그 이유는 오류 메시지에 제공됩니다.
일부 오류 응답:
429 TooManyRequests - 요청이 제한됩니다. "x-ms-ratelimit-microsoft.consumption-retry-after" 헤더에 지정된 시간을 기다린 후 다시 시도합니다.
503 ServiceUnavailable - 서비스를 일시적으로 사용할 수 없습니다. "Retry-After" 헤더에 지정된 시간을 기다린 후 다시 시도합니다.
Name | 형식 | Description |
---|---|---|
error |
오류의 세부 정보입니다. |
OperationStatus
장기 실행 작업의 상태입니다.
Name | 형식 | Description |
---|---|---|
properties.downloadFileProperties |
다운로드한 파일의 속성 |
|
properties.downloadUrl |
string |
가격표를 다운로드할 링크(URL)입니다. |
properties.validTill |
string |
링크 유효성을 다운로드합니다. |
status |
장기 실행 작업의 상태입니다. |
OperationStatusType
장기 실행 작업의 상태입니다.
Name | 형식 | Description |
---|---|---|
Completed |
string |
|
Failed |
string |
|
Running |
string |